Reality star, Ikechukwu Sunday Okonkwo, aka Cross, has revealed that his dad was actually assassinated.

Cross revealed this in a recent interview with Arise TV.

While sharing what the d3ath of his father had thought him and his family, the reality star said, they were forced to love one another and protect each other MORE.

He says soon has his father left, his mom and siblings all started looking out for each other.

He also pointed out that, his father’s d3ath made them realsise one shouldn’t take life too deeply.

Hmm, he said, “I don’t hold grudges. I got that part of love from my mum and siblings. After my dad got assassinated, it was more or less like we need to protect ourselves. So, right there, we became one another’s protectors. By sticking together and protecting ourselves, we realised that you shouldn’t take life too deep. You should put it on the surface, and what will happen will happen.”
